The Winnipeg FIR is looking to add to it’s senior leadership by hiring our new Chief Instructor! While fairly self-explanatory of a title, the Chief Instructor of Winnipeg holds many various duties.

POSITION: Winnipeg Chief Instructor, ZWG3

REPORTS TO: Winnipeg FIR Chief, Deputy Chief & VATCAN Executive Team (if Applicable)

RESPONSIBLE FOR: Leading Winnipeg’s training team, as well as (but not limited to) the following:

  • Leading the FIR’s Instructors and Mentors, as well as assisting FIR students when needed.
  • Implementing, modifying (if required) and overseeing all training of students, as well as monitoring exams when able.
  • Coordinating with other FIR Staff and VATCAN’s Training Director (VATCAN3).
  • Maintaining consistent contact with students to ensure continued activity while in training.
  • Working with the FIR Staff to provide support when necessary.
  • Additional duties, as assigned.

M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S: The successful applicant should meet the following minimum standards:

  • Be a member of good standing in VATCAN for more than one year at the time of application.
  • Demonstrated ability to make and keep commitments.
  • A minimum of a Controller (C1) rating, though an Instructor (I1) rating or greater is preferred.
  • Real world credentials and training, mentoring or any work as a leader are considered an asset
  • Be able to work effectively and build relationships within a volunteer organization.
